Apple stock tends to fall after big product launches

Thanks to the folks at Statista for putting these charts together. With the iPhone 5 due to be announced soon, it's interesting to see that only two of the five previous iPhones caused the stock to appreciate 4-5 days later. Click to enlarge:

    Since AAPL's typical price behavior around announcements is now in public domain, chances are this pattern will vanish. The question is how it will morph. Three options: a) price action becomes fully random b) decline will happen prior to the announcement c) stock will have a tendency to rise after announcement because traders sold in anticipation of the decline. Don't forget that this stock is one of the favorite toys of hedge funds.
